Which engines/controllers can be updated?
Engines:
starting from 8/2003 BDB
starting from 9/2004 BMJ
starting from 11/2005 BOY (only the first variants)
The following engine expensive devices can be updated:
022906032CA
022906032CB
022906032GH
022906032GJ

What do I say to the dealer?
You heard that AUDI a software update makes available for the VR6 3.2-Liter-Motoren, which the Motorruckeln, vibrating, jerky no-load operation and power loss are to repair.
What, if it does not know or finds the update?
Give it the TPL procedure number: 2005748/4
Internal message code 8P01A005 or the updates CD No. 4F0 906,961 N is needed
Thus a good dealer can always which with begin
How is the update up-played?
By means of diagnostic system of the dealer
What costs me the update?
The car is not still in the guarantee period might costs develop. He is not outside of the guarantee period a good dealer anything will require. Usually become with a strange dealer around the 50. - Euro requires, what corresponds to a work expended of approx. 20-30 minutes.
How long does the update last?
Usually not longer than 30 minutes

What is GeKo?
GeKo (secret and component protection) is a function, those with on-line binding of the diagnostic tester VAS 5052 the users for the order stands and training going away barrier components (e.g. Combination instrument, engine expensive equipment), keys and the component protection (air conditioner, navigation etc.) to the vehicle makes possible.
What is SVM?
SVM (software version management) is a further function, which is made available with on-line binding of the diagnostic tester VAS 5052. Thus a process-safe controller programming as well as the correct controller sheeting are made possible. The function offers additionally a support with the coding of controllers.

A3 3.2 VR6 Lambdasonde with error registration and the procedure number 2010154/1.
The following stands there in it:
Problem description: Engine check lamp shines.
In the engine expensive equipment the error is P2626 or P2629 put down is called that the Lambdasondenheizung is defective and the Lambdasonde must be renewed.
A cause
By a software fault (Pfui!
) the Lambdasonde under certain circumstances is too fast heated and can be damaged thereby.
Series-solution
Conversion to the new engine often commodity starting from chassis number WAUZZZ 8P % 6 A 073016
Solution
Please the defective Lambdasonde renews and the engine expensive equipment with the internal message code 8P01A005 on-line one, or with the CD 4F0 906,961 N updates.
The following engine expensive devices can be updated:
022906032CA
022906032CB
022906032GH
022906032GJ
